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    interazione fra livelli

    Ragazzi mi potete dire se è giusto perfavore? Perchè a me non funziona.

    Questo è uno script che ho messo in un pulsante che sta sul livello 10, vorrei che cliccando caricasse il livello 12 metterlo in play dal suo frame 35.

    on (release) {
    loadMovieNum("images/interfaccia_eurospace.swf", 12);
    _level12.play();
    gotoAndPlay(35);
    }

    Grazie
    Ciao

  2. #2
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    up

    .

  3. #3
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    up

    .

  4. #4
    loadMovieNum non rende immediatamente disponibile l'accessibilita' al livello



    on (release) {
    loadMovieNum("images/interfaccia_eurospace.swf", 12);

    this.onEnterFrame = function() {
    if( _level12 != undefined && _level12.getBytesLoaded() >= _level12.getBytesTotal() ) {
    _level12.play();
    gotoAndPlay(35);
    delete this.onEnterFrame;
    }
    }
    }
    Formaldehyde a new Ajax PHP Zero Config Error Debugger

    WebReflection @WebReflection

  5. #5
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    grazie andr3a x avermi risposto

    Mammamia quant'è complicato! Da solo non ci sarei mai arrivato. Ora provo a inserire lo script sul bottone, ti faccio sapere se mi funziona.

  6. #6
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    .

    E' strano, il livello lo carica però parte dal primo frame e non dal 35. Secondo te quale può essere il problema?

  7. #7
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    .

    Ma questa riga di codice a che serve?

    if (_level12 != undefined && _level12.getBytesLoaded()>=_level12.getBytesTotal( )) {

  8. #8

    Re: .

    Originariamente inviato da prinzart
    E' strano, il livello lo carica però parte dal primo frame e non dal 35. Secondo te quale può essere il problema?
    se il gotoAndPlay(35) e' per il level 12 allora devi fare cosi':



    on (release) {
    loadMovieNum("images/interfaccia_eurospace.swf", 12);

    this.onEnterFrame = function() {
    if( _level12 != undefined && _level12.getBytesLoaded() >= _level12.getBytesTotal() ) {
    _level12.gotoAndPlay(35);
    delete this.onEnterFrame;
    }
    }
    }





    invece questa:
    if( _level12 != undefined && _level12.getBytesLoaded() >= _level12.getBytesTotal() ) {

    serve a non far niente finche' il _level12 non e' caricato ... altrimenti se non c'e' che vuoi playare ???
    Formaldehyde a new Ajax PHP Zero Config Error Debugger

    WebReflection @WebReflection

  9. #9
    Utente di HTML.it
    Registrato dal
    Mar 2001
    Messaggi
    2,043

    SIIIIII

    Ok così funziona Grazie!! Ehh ne ho ancora di cose da imparare su flash...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.